The Postgaarden has a superb location near the fjord, in the charming market town of Mariager, and offers a cosy and authentic base for a wonderful Danish holiday, with plenty of experiences within a short distance.
The building has existed since 1660, and offers a unique historical atmosphere that has been carefully preserved to this day. Over the years, several prominent people have visited the cosy inn, such as H.C. Andersen, Sir Elton John, Queen Margrethe and Prince Henrik.

Hotel Postgaarden Mariager has 14 individually decorated rooms, all beautifully renovated with bright and pleasant colours, and all kept in a charming old style. Both single and double rooms are available and all rooms are furnished with private bath and toilet, and equipped with comfortable beds, sitting area and TV with Danish and international channels.
